Middlesbrough news and transfer rumours: Middlesbrough close in on Nathaniel Mendez-Laing and are linked with late move for Fulham's Neeskens Kebano

Middlesbrough are closing in on the signing of former Cardiff City winger Nathaniel Mendez-Laing and have been linked with a late loan move for Fulham midfielder Neeskens Kebano.

Mendez-Laing, who is a free agent after his contract was terminated by Cardiff in September, travelled to Rockliffe on Monday evening to complete his medical and the signing is expected to be announced.

Boro boss Neil Warnock is still keen to bolster his attacking options, and it’s been claimed that Kebano has emerged as a late target.

The 28-year-old has made just five Premier League appearances for Fulham this season and can play in multiple midfield positions.

According to Football Insider, Boro are trying to beat the 11pm transfer deadline to sign the player until the end of the season.

Kebano moved to Craven Cottage in the summer of 2016 and has helped the Cottergers win promotion from the Championship on two occasions.
